Definitions:

Superego

In Freudian psychoanalysis, a component of the psyche that operates as the ethical component of personality, providing moral standards and aspirations.

Collective Unconscious

A concept proposed by Carl Jung, referring to the part of the unconscious mind that is derived from ancestral memory and experience and is common to all humankind.

Ego

The part of the psyche that mediates between the conscious, the unconscious, and the external world, according to Freudian psychology.

Erogenous Zones

Areas of the body that are particularly sensitive to sexual stimulation.
